Notes
Asked for .6# of TF peat smoked malt instead of .06#... so now it's a smoked peat scotch ale! This is pushing the limit on this smoked malt so hopefully a lot of smoke is all I get. Doesn't smell or taste bad from the boil so hopefully that's the case after it ferments.
Brewed 28FEB2017
Gravity 08APR2017 was 1.022, attenuation adjusted
Update 19AUG2017
This beer actually came out pretty darn good. Sweet, smokey, but I personally don't find it overpowering. I think it will age well.
